Metropolitan Police will not charge Kneecap over 'kill your local MP' comments at London gig

  • The Metropolitan Police will not charge Kneecap for allegedly calling on people to "kill your local MP," citing the statutory time limit for prosecution as the reason for the decision.
  • Kneecap issued an apology to the families of murdered MPs Jo Cox and David Amess earlier this year.
  • The Metropolitan Police stated that the safety and security of MPs is taken extremely seriously across the whole of policing.
  • Counter-Terrorism detectives conducted a thorough investigation and concluded that no further action is necessary regarding the alleged comments made by Kneecap.
